Hello, I'm looking at getting some Method 703's for my new JTR, ideally, I'd pick up the 25mm offset 5.78" backspacing flavor to keep the wheel tucked under the Gladiator as much as possible, similar to a stock wheel. I've seen people run these without issue however the next step will probably be getting a 2.5"/3.5" Clayton Offroad Overland Plus lift kit and the kit recommends the 0 offset / 4.75" backspacing.
Has anyone tried these 25mm offset wheels with a Clayton kit? This would be similar to AEV wheels for 17"x8.5. Do you rub the control arms with a 12.5" wide tire? I'm looking at getting 37x12.5r17 BFG KO2's.
The rubicon supposedly has 1.5" wider axles than other Gladiators, does that help me pick up the higher offset wheel?
